intolerable

[ in-tol-er-uh-buhl ]
/ ɪnˈtɒl ər ə bəl /
SEE SYNONYMS FOR intolerable ON THESAURUS.COM

adjective

not tolerable; unendurable; insufferable: intolerable pain.
excessive.

Origin of intolerable

First recorded in 1400–50; late Middle English word from Latin word intolerābilis.See in-3, tolerable

intolerable
/ (ɪnˈtɒlərəbəl) /

adjective

more than can be tolerated or endured; insufferable
informal extremely irritating or annoying

Derived forms of intolerable

intolerability or intolerableness, nounintolerably, adverb
